 2,6-Dimethoxy-1,4-benzoquinone Biological Activity

Description 2,6-Dimethoxy-1,4-benzoquinone, a natural phytochemical, is a known haustorial inducing factor. 2,6-Dimethoxy-1,4-benzoquinone exerts anti-cancer, anti-inflammatory, anti-adipogenic, antibacterial, and antimalaria effects[1].子

 Chemical & Physical Properties

Density 1.2±0.1 g/cm3
Boiling Point 311.1±42.0 °C at 760 mmHg
Melting Point 253-257 °C (dec.)(lit.)
Molecular Formula C8H8O4
Molecular Weight 168.147
Flash Point 139.2±27.9 °C
Exact Mass 168.042252
PSA 52.60000
LogP 0.28
Vapour Pressure 0.0±0.7 mmHg at 25°C
Index of Refraction 1.504
Stability Stable. Combustible. Incompatible with oxidizing agents.
